Vadlyn: A Bold Font for Modern Gothic Expression

Vadlyn is a striking blackletter typeface that masterfully bridges the gap between traditional gothic lettering and contemporary design sensibilities. Its sharp, elegant forms are both visually arresting and highly versatile, making it an excellent choice for designers who want to make a strong typographic statement. With its dramatic curves and bold strokes, Vadlyn isn't just a font—it's a tool for evoking emotion, power, and a sense of timeless artistry in any creative project.

What Makes Vadlyn Unique?

Blackletter fonts have long been associated with medieval manuscripts, heraldry, and historical branding. What sets Vadlyn apart is its ability to modernize these classic elements without losing their essence. The contrast between thick and thin strokes gives it a dynamic presence, while the refined structure ensures legibility even at smaller sizes. This balance makes Vadlyn ideal for both decorative and functional use cases.

Unlike many gothic fonts that can appear overly ornate or difficult to read, Vadlyn maintains clarity through subtle adjustments in spacing and form. These enhancements allow it to serve as a headline font, a brand identifier, or even a body text in the right context—especially when paired with more minimalist supporting typography.

Applications Across Creative Fields

Vadlyn’s visual strength lends itself well to a wide array of projects. Below are some of the most effective ways to leverage this typeface across different industries and formats:

Logo Design

For businesses seeking a bold identity, Vadlyn offers a unique way to stand out. Whether you're designing a logo for a boutique winery, a high-end fashion label, or a music venue, this font can communicate sophistication with a hint of rebellion. Consider using Vadlyn in combination with simpler sans-serif fonts for contrast, especially if your brand needs to maintain a professional yet edgy image.

Tattoo Art and Body Branding

In tattoo design, Vadlyn provides a fresh alternative to the usual script or traditional block-letter styles. Its structured elegance works beautifully for names, mottos, or symbolic phrases. Because of its strong visual impact, it's also great for larger designs where readability and style need to coexist. Always ensure the design is clean enough for the skin and test how it looks at various scales before finalizing.

Album Covers and Music Branding

Musicians and producers in genres like rock, metal, or indie folk will find Vadlyn particularly compelling. It adds a layer of mystique and gravitas to album titles and band logos. Pair it with dark color palettes, vintage textures, or hand-drawn illustrations to amplify the aesthetic. For digital platforms like Spotify or Apple Music, consider using a lighter version or simplified variant of Vadlyn to maintain visibility on small screens.

Posters and Print Media

Event posters, movie trailers, or exhibition banners often rely on typography to set the tone. Vadlyn’s dramatic flair makes it perfect for such uses. Try combining it with drop shadows, gradients, or metallic effects to create a powerful visual hierarchy. When designing for print, be mindful of ink coverage and contrast to avoid muddy results.

Apparel and Merchandise

On clothing tags, packaging, or promotional gear, Vadlyn can add a touch of sophistication or rebellion depending on the treatment. Use it sparingly for maximum effect—for example, as part of a slogan or brand name. Ensure the font size is large enough for visibility from a distance and consider its placement on curved surfaces like t-shirts or mugs for optimal readability.

Practical Tips for Using Vadlyn Effectively

To get the most out of Vadlyn, consider the following best practices:

  1. Limit Usage: Due to its strong character, overusing Vadlyn can overwhelm a design. Save it for headlines, titles, or key phrases where it can shine.
  2. Prioritize Readability: While Vadlyn is visually rich, ensure that the message remains clear. Avoid using it for lengthy paragraphs unless stylized for artistic purposes.
  3. Test Across Platforms: Before finalizing a design, check how Vadlyn appears on different devices and media. Sometimes what looks great on screen may require tweaking for print or mobile display.
  4. Pair Thoughtfully: Choose complementary fonts that enhance Vadlyn’s personality. A clean sans-serif or a soft serif can provide balance and guide the viewer’s eye through the composition.
  5. Stay Consistent: If you decide to use Vadlyn in multiple pieces (e.g., social media posts, packaging, website), apply it consistently to build brand recognition and reinforce your visual identity.
